Springer-Verlag, Berlin / New York, 1989. Hardcover. Good. 8vo, hardcover. No dj. Good condition. Non-circulating ex-lib copy w/ front endpaper removed, light markings to opening pgs, spine label very neatly removed; contents bright & clean, binding tight. xix, 627 p. Proceedings of an International Workshop on High Precision Navigation, May 1988 in Stuttgart; organized by the Sonderforschungsbereich 228 (SFB 228), Hochgenaue Navigation - Integration navigatorischer und geodätischer Methoden.
